So many new issues arise when a child develops a life-limiting illness. Not just for the child but for their loved ones as well.
Our aim at Chestnut Tree House is to provide the care and support these families so desperately need, whether practical, physical or emotional.
Over 750 women walked ten miles from midnight until dawn in Eastbourne on Saturday 18 May 2013, raising over £96,000 for Chestnut Tree House.
